Output 8b757595331df36cbd55d606a07fb61c64bc40e781217b3f501d00a525ebcbf0:0

value
32605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d68e84217663a7e27c81a121fcc1bbc881b2d7e OP_EQUAL
address
3BfXFY7ytg5oBPA5Vsxv1BAUm8qmAUw74Y
transaction
8b757595331df36cbd55d606a07fb61c64bc40e781217b3f501d00a525ebcbf0
spent
true